Solicitors and counsel

Better prepared clients make better professional instructions.

If you are looking for live, properly prepared client referrals, we can help by bringing matters to an instruction-ready or court-ready stage before referral.

From scattered papers to structured work

Our model is simple. We prepare clients before referral. That means the case has already been reviewed, the core evidence has been organised, the relevant documents have been bundled, and a concise case summary has been prepared.

Where appropriate, cases are stress-tested before they reach you. Weak points, evidential gaps and procedural issues are identified early. This means you receive clients who are better prepared, better informed and easier to advise.

There is no referral fee. The partnership discussion is about contribution to the cost of our paralegal preparation centre where a client is brought to the point of having an organised bundle, a short case summary and documents ready for filing, service or further professional input.

Instead of starting with a confused client, scattered documents and half a story, you receive a structured matter with the key issues already distilled.

Prepared referral work

We reduce the administrative fog before the matter reaches you.

For solicitors, this can provide a source of better prepared client work. For counsel, it can create a smoother route to properly framed instructions, with the factual and evidential groundwork already done.

Case summary

A concise summary identifying the background, core issues, remedy sought, key evidence and obvious risks.

Evidence bundle

Relevant documents gathered, sorted and paginated so the professional adviser is not starting with a document dump.

Issue and gap analysis

Helpful documents, harmful documents and missing evidence identified before professional time is spent expensively.

Instruction-ready papers

Where appropriate, documents are prepared to support filing, service, advice, drafting or further formal legal input.
